Output d95b3fbac6e193f60ef6b63c40407dda69d8a751cfa72c6c265feb635690b72e:0

value
20142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d91ba663e23b4c2f78f9895f0ba746eb12c1959ee4d2485ddb870c27d6c19617
address
bc1pmyd6vclz8dxz778e390shf6xavfvr9v7unfyshwmsuxz04kpjctsr0y99m
transaction
d95b3fbac6e193f60ef6b63c40407dda69d8a751cfa72c6c265feb635690b72e
confirmations
88375
spent
true